The Frame
The bill would have created new criminal penalties for firearm owners and established a state-run registry for specific weapons, impacting the legal rights and obligations of current firearm owners and dealers.
Potentially affected actors named in the source documents. Mention is not a position.
Firearm owners
Owners of specific firearms would have been required to register their weapons or face criminal penalties.
Licensed gun dealers
Dealers would have been subject to new restrictions on the sale and transfer of assault weapons and large-capacity magazines.
Department of Law Enforcement
The department would have been tasked with creating a new certification system, conducting background checks, and maintaining a registry of weapons.

Mandatory Sentencing Enhancement
The bill proposed a significant increase in mandatory minimum sentences for existing felonies if an assault weapon or large-capacity magazine was involved, effectively reclassifying the severity of those crimes.
